FREE delivery Thu, Feb 15 . More Buying Choices $56.70 (2 used & new offers) Display Size:Real Temp is a temperature monitoring program designed for all modern Intel processors. Each core on these processors has a digital thermal sensor (DTS) that reports temperature data relative to TJMax which is the safe maximum operating core temperature for the CPU.
